#b17017 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b17017 is composed of 69.4% red, 43.9%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 87%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 39.2%. #b17017 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e02e with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#b17017 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#b17017 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b17017 has RGB values of R:177, G:112,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.87,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11628567.

Shades and Tints of #b17017
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b17017
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646464 is the less saturated color, while #c07208 is the most saturated one.
